About Paluxy RV Park
What sets Paluxy RV Park apart is its rare combination of tranquil seclusion and convenient access, offering campers a peaceful retreat with all the essentials while situated just minutes from Glen Rose’s most celebrated attractions. This compact, well-maintained RV park features spacious gravel sites, many with pull-through options, full hookups, and a serene atmosphere enhanced by shady trees and a grassy landscape. Its simple yet thoughtful amenities, such as free Wi-Fi, ensure a comfortable stay without unnecessary frills.
Located directly along Highway 67 in Glen Rose, Texas, the park’s prime location is less than a 10-minute drive from Dinosaur Valley State Park, where visitors can explore fossilized dinosaur tracks, scenic hiking trails, and the Paluxy River. Fossil Rim Wildlife Center, renowned for its safari-like experience with exotic animals, is just 15 minutes away. With its quiet environment, convenient road access, and proximity to outdoor adventures, Paluxy RV Park accommodates everything from short stopovers to relaxing weekend getaways.
